Story summary
- James Pickens Jr., known for Grey's Anatomy, disclosed in 2024 that a checkup revealed prostate cancer and that he had a robotic radical prostatectomy.
- He began PSA testing at 41 due to a family history of prostate cancer.
- Pickens advocates proactive health measures for Black men after learning that the cancer had not spread.
- The American Cancer Society recommends PSA tests beginning at age 50 for average-risk men.
